Suddenly getting skin reaction at injection site

4 replies

ChittyChittyBoomBoom · 17/01/2025 10:45

I’ve just taken my 17th injection and all have been fine apart from the last 2. I’m on 5mg and for the last 2 injections, I’ve come out with a red, raised and very itchy area where I’ve injected. The first took and week to fully go away.

Im assuming it’s some kind of histamine response but why now suddenly??

im going to contact my prescriber for advice but wondered if anyone else has had the same?

WeAllHaveWings · 17/01/2025 13:56

I got it more when I moved supplier and they changed to a shorter needle length and brand. It was really bad and each one would be itchy for 10+ days and red for 3 weeks, so any any point I would have 3 visible injection sites visible.

I bought a box of my original needles and it wasn't as bad, still red but not itchy and cleared within 3-5 days.

I think I was having a reaction to their brand of needle design/coating.

I have seen other posts saying if you are using 4mm changing to a longer needle 6mm can help a bit to take the medication slightly further away from the sensitive skin layer and reduce the reaction.

WeAllHaveWings · 17/01/2025 20:32

It was the BD viva 4mm needles (from Oushk) I reacted to, I tried their BD Viva 6mm and it was a little better, so I bought a box of 100 of the ones I had previously Novofine 6mm (from ZAVA) and it made a huge difference.
